III. Breakdown of the Complete Same-Sex Surrogacy Cycle Process in 2026

Regardless of the chosen country, a complete same-sex surrogacy cycle includes the following six key stages. Understanding the specifics of each stage helps in better planning time and budget.

Stage 1: Consultation and Evaluation (about 1 to 2 weeks)
Clients need to provide basic health information and needs. The institution recommends suitable countries, hospitals, and plans based on the situation. This stage requires clarifying the source of sperm, egg donation needs, and surrogate requirements.

Stage 2: Examination and Matching (about 1 to 2 months)
Clients undergo a comprehensive physical examination at the designated hospital, including infectious disease screening, genetic disease testing, and reproductive function assessment. Simultaneously, the institution begins matching egg donors and surrogates. At the Kyrgyzstan Tulip Reproductive Center and Thailand OneLife Wanlai Reproductive Center, matching is usually faster, with an average waiting time of 3 to 4 weeks.

Stage 3: Embryo Cultivation and Screening (about 1 month)
After egg retrieval, embryos are formed with sperm and cultured for 5 to 6 days to the blastocyst stage. In 2026, PGT-A genetic screening has become standard, allowing for the selection of chromosomally normal embryos, significantly improving transfer success rates. This stage takes about 3 to 4 weeks.

Stage 4: Transfer Preparation (about 2 to 4 weeks)
The surrogate needs to undergo hormone replacement therapy to prepare the endometrium to an optimal receptive state. The transfer window is typically days 18 to 22 of the menstrual cycle.

Stage 5: Embryo Transfer and Pregnancy Confirmation (about 2 weeks)
The transfer is performed under ultrasound guidance, and a blood HCG test is done 10 to 12 days after to confirm pregnancy. A fetal heartbeat can be seen via ultrasound around the 4th week after transfer.

Stage 6: Pregnancy Management and Birth Processing (about 7 to 9 months)
After pregnancy confirmation, the surrogate enters routine prenatal check-ups. Clients need to assist with obtaining the birth certificate, establishing parentage, and return procedures. In Kyrgyzstan and Thailand, this stage is highly standardized.

Q: What is the difference between a gay male surrogacy cycle and a lesbian surrogacy cycle?

A: A gay male surrogacy cycle requires both an egg donor and a surrogate, involving two separate stages of egg source matching and surrogate matching. A lesbian surrogacy cycle usually involves one partner retrieving eggs and the other partner or a surrogate carrying the pregnancy, requiring only surrogate matching. Therefore, the matching phase for gay male cycles takes slightly longer, but the overall cycle length is similar.
